SALES #1

Anytime I talk to anyone who knows little about sales, they tell me that sales is a personality gift you receive at birth, an art! Sales is anything but. People have a perception of sales people that it is there job to sell as much to you as possible and to get the most money from you in the quickest time possible.

What people don’t recognise is that a professional sales person see themselves as someone who helps the customer buy a product or service that will fulfil a need that they have. People also don’t recognise that sales is a precise mathematical equation. Without getting all technical on anyone, it simple boils down to personal ratios. More on that later.

Sales is also a skill that can be learned. I order to learn sales you need to be open to 3 things:
• Knowledge
• Skills
• Attitude.

The ‘skills’ of sales is just one part of the learning process. Let me explain what I mean!
The knowledge is the information you need. This is the theory behind why you do certain things in sales.
The skills part is putting the knowledge in to practice. It is fine tuning how to do sales.
The attitude is the most important part of the process. The attitude is the want to do. This is the most important part because if you have the knowledge and the skills but have no motivation or want to practice and get out there to do it, guess what?? You’ll never be a sales person.

So in order to increase sales in your company, you need to either hire someone who has the right attitude to sales, the job and your company.
If you look after sales yourself with in your company, you need to work on all three areas in order to become proficient at sales.
